Highlights
Is it cheaper to live in Sun Prairie or is it cheaper to live in Chillum?
- Sun Prairie is 14.4% less expensive than Chillum.

Which city has more affordable housing, Sun Prairie or Chillum?
- Sun Prairie housing costs are 20.7% less expensive than Chillum housing costs.

Is Health Care more affordable in Chillum or is Health Care more affordable in Sun Prairie.
- Health related expenses are 6.5% more in Sun Prairie.
